Somerset County Seeks Photos for Photo Contest

Do you have a favorite photo of Somerset County?

By Somerset County

Do you have a favorite photo of Somerset County? We’re looking for photos to be featured on the county website or published in the Somerset County Business Partnership’s “Destination Guide.”

The Board of Chosen Freeholders is sponsoring a “Show us Somerset County through your camera lens” photo contest, which is open to residents and employees of Somerset County. The deadline for entries is Friday, Oct. 16.

“Somerset County is in the process of redesigning its website and we plan to feature images that depict our county as a great place to live, work and play,” said Freeholder Director Mark Caliguire. “We look forward to seeing what residents love about Somerset County.”

The Somerset County Business Partnership is seeking photos that show people enjoying attractions within the county for its 2015-2016 “Somerset County Destination Guide.” For more information, contact Tourism Director Jacqueline Morales at jmorales@scbp.org or 908-218-4300.

Up to a total of five digital photos, in color or black and white, can be submitted for the website and the guide. Entries will be reviewed by both Somerset County and the Business Partnership.

Electronic submissions can be sent to photocontest@co.somerset.nj.us. CD’s can be mailed to Somerset County Photo Contest, County Administrator’s Office, P.O. Box 3000, Somerville, NJ 08876. Entries will not be returned.

Photo Contest entries should reflect one of five themes:

  • Community – for example, neighborhoods, important local places
  • Natural Environment – for example, lakes, rivers, forests, parks, or wildlife
  • Architecture and Urban Design – including plazas, buildings, boulevards, etc.
  • Transportation – for example, streets, buses, trains, bicycle & pedestrian paths
  • Arts & Culture – including museums, events, entertainment, public art, etc.

A completed entry form must be submitted with each photo. Contestants are responsible for acquiring photo releases from identifiable individuals featured in the photographs. See photo contest instructions for more information.

A panel of judges will select a winner and runner up for each Photo Contest theme, as well as an overall contest winner. Winners will be notified by mail or e-mail. Top entries may be showcased on the redesigned county website and on printed materials.
